Brazil Soy Crush Estimate Revised Downward
08.07.09
This week, the Brazilian Vegetable Oils Industry Association revised downward the country’s 2008-2009 soy crush estimate to 30.9 million mt from 31.6 million mt.
Brazil is also forecast to produce 57.3 million mt of soybeans from the 2008-09 crop, down from the Association’s last estimate of 57.4 million mt on July 4.
